WebPrinciples of Heat Transfer. Heat is transferred to and from objects -- such as you and your home -- through three processes: conduction, radiation, and convection. Conduction is heat traveling through a solid material. On hot days, heat is conducted into your home through the roof, walls, and windows. Heat-reflecting roofs, insulation, and ... WebInduction heating focuses energy in your part only; no torch or costly batch or furnace process needed. ... With induction shrink fitting, you use thermal expansion to fit or remove parts. A metal component is heated to 150-300 °C (305-572 °F), and that causes it to expand. This allows for the removal or insertion of a part. Webcalled salol (C 13 H 10 O 3) and an impure sample.
